If you have had the money in your account for the six months covered by the requested bank statements then immigration will not care much where it came from. It's clearly yours, and that's what they care about. Plus if your husband is paying for your trip, and his financial situation is good enough to be able to afford that, then the presence of that money won't make the difference between acceptance and rejection.

The reason for explaining fund origins is to prevent the suspicion that you have arranged a short term boost to your account to make it look like you have enough money when you don't. Since you clearly haven't done that there won't be a problem.

Of course explaining the money origin won't hurt. Write it in the notes or cover letter if you are in any doubt.
